Lady Bears tie Co-Lin, 2-2, in double overtime

Playing through extreme conditions, the Southwest Lady Bears left Wesson Friday night with a 2-2 double-overtime tie with home standing Co-Lin in MACJC South Division soccer action. The teams battled themselves as well as almost constant rain.
 
Jessica St. Pierre put the Southwest ladies (0-7-1) on top 1-0 with an unassisted goal at 17:00 of the first half in the opening match. Co-Lin (0-10, 0-5 South) made the score 1-1 at the half when Caitlin Lofton scored at 25:00.
 
The score remained tied until the 70:00 mark when Daniela Orozco put the hosts on top 2-1. A free kick from the Lady Bears' Nicole Daigle at 83:00 tied the game at 2-2. St. Pierre recorded an assist. The game ended in a 2-2 tie when neither team was able to score in the two extra periods.
 
The Lady Bears are set to travel to Senatobia Tuesday to face the Lady Rangers of Northwest. The non-division matchup is set to get underway at 2:00.
